Medicine in stamps-Ignaz Semmelweis and Puerperal Fever

Puerperal fever was common in mid-19(th)-century hospitals and often fatal, with mortality at 10%–35%. Ignaz Philipp Semmelweis was a Hungarian gynecologist who is known as a pioneer of antiseptic procedures.
